Tighter Budgets in the Kingdom

Prince Charming presented his proposal to the Committee for Princess Finding - that he would personally take a detachment from the Palace Guard to scour the land for the lady whose foot fit the glass slipper left behind.

However, a member of the committee (potentially the day job of a wicked step mother or ugly sister) came up with an alternative option – put out a proclamation on the Royal Web backed up by an application form to allow potential princesses to register their shoe size.

Of course, the second option was adopted as it was cheaper, and viewed as a better use of resources. Cinderella did not have access to the Royal Web and so remained unaware of the proclamation and never registered her shoe size.

When all the entries had been screened, it was determined that none of the shoe size matches fitted the glass slipper and so a potential princess was not found.

Prince Charming returned to the Committee for Princess Finding to revisit his idea of manual scouring of the land. However, expenditure on the Proclamation exceeded expectations and so there was not enough money for any further searches.

Everybody lived, but not particularly happily.
